Amazing but true...only 2 lines of AFL code allow you to load any layout you want.  But where is the documentation? 
 
Thanks so much dingo!
 

AB = CreateObject("Broker.Application");

Test=AB.LoadLayout("C:\\yourlayoutdirectory\\yourlayout.awl");

Dim oAB
 
Const cstLayoutDir = "C:\Program Files\Amibroker\Layouts\"
 
Set oAB = CreateObject("Broker.Application")
oAB.Visible = True
 
oAB.LoadLayout(cstLayoutDir + "Daily Index Monitor.awl")
 
Set oAB  = Nothing
